Is Lakeville, MA a Good Place to Live?

Lakeville receives an overall livability grade of A (80/100), placing it among the better areas in Massachusetts. Safety scores A+ (99/100), indicating lower crime rates than most areas. Affordability scores A (84/100) with a median household income of $119,712 and median home values around $503,200.

About 38.2%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and the unemployment rate is 4.7%. 85% of housing is owner-occupied. The median age is 41.
